The LaMMA Consortium, Environmental Modelling and Monitoring Laboratory combines CNR's scientific research skills with the administrative body's commitment to public service, to develop products and services for the local area and for the collectivity. 


From studying phenomena to serving the region
LaMMA is strongly scientific in character. Its research mission, which gave rise to the La.M.M.A. laboratory in 1997, is still an important factor, and one which embraces all its spheres of activity. The study and observation of phenomena are the true heart of research, and these are the foundations on which the consortium builds its operations in order to develop solutions and tailor-made services for Tuscany and its environment.  

The Consortium's main domains of competence are:

METEOROLOGY - Regional weather service and diffusion models
LaMMA is home to the Tuscany weather forecasting service, which constantly monitors atmospheric conditions and produces daily reports 7 days a week.  In addition to the regional weather forecast, LaMMA also provides “customised” services, with weather reports specifically designed for different categories of users.  Together with the air quality section, the meteorology department develops diffusion models to simulate the dispersion of pollutants in the atmosphere.

TERRITORY -  Information systems for the management of environmental risks and resources
LaMMA integrates satellite observation with the use of geographic information systems, thus offering systems and tools to interpret the environment and manage its dynamics and evolution. Nowadays, geographical information products, such as risk maps, geographical databases and thematic maps, are indispensable tools for monitoring natural and man-made changes in the environment, with an eye to sustainable management.
 
SEA - Integrated sea monitoring
LaMMA performs research in the field of marine environmental monitoring, by collecting and processing measured and remotely gathered data, and applying marine meteorology, hydrodynamic and biogeochemical models. By applying the results of its research locally, LaMMA provides useful tools for the development of policies and strategies for the protection and control of the marine and coastal environment.   

CLIMATE and ENERGY - Climate change and reduction of climate-altering emissions
LaMMA analyses the region's climatology from a range of spatial and temporal perspectives in order to better understand the changes taking place. LaMMA is also home to the Region of Tuscany's Focal Point Kyoto, which provides the region with support in its strategies for mitigating and adapting to climate change. Focal Point Kyoto offers a more complete understanding of local environmental sustainability, integrating the carbon balance (emissions and absorption) with fact-finding tools useful in decision making for environmental and energy management and planning.
